What is Right-Size Packaging? 

Right-size packaging uses technology to tailor each package to the exact size of its contents, minimizing waste. When a right-sized package is created, it’s optimized to fit the contents as closely as possible, minimizing excess material and wasted space. Smaller, right-sized packages mean lower shipping and dimensional (DIM) weight charges. When shipping a right-sized package, as volume increases so do the savings.

Paper Recycling and Certification Requirements

While widely assumed as recyclable, not all paper packaging qualifies as recyclable. Third-party tests – such as the 4Evergreen or Fibre Box Association (FBA) voluntary standard tests, which can qualify paper as certified recyclable.

FBA Parts 1 and 2

FBA features two levels of testing: Part 1 tests for paper repulpability (ability to dissolve in water) and Part 2 tests for paper recyclability.

FBA Part 1, Repulpability Testing

FBA Part 1 involves a pass or fail test to determine the fiber yield to see if the paper can be repulped into another product (i.e., if the fiber is available for recycling).

For example, paper packaging that contains an adhesive as a sealant to close the package can be tested for repulpability. If the repulpability score is very high during the tests, it means the adhesive is released from the paper fiber and is available for recycling into another product. However, if the repulbability score is low and the paper fails the tests, it means the adhesive is too aggressive and doesn’t release enough from the fiber to qualify as repulpable. Utilizing eco-friendly adhesives is an ideal solution for sustainable paper packaging as they are soluble in water and ensures a clean re-pulping process.

FBA Part 2, Recyclability Testing

The FBA Part 2 recyclability test, also a pass or fail test, is a longer and more rigorous test than the FBA Part 1 for Repulpability. FBA Part 2 gauges the paper’s strength and optical and surface properties to determine if the fiber is good for reuse in paper/paperboard.

Western Michigan University (WMU) offers the FBA parts 1 and 2 paper repulbability and recyclability testing and certification program. In addition, WMU is a partner organization of the How2Recycle program. Paper packaging that successfully passes parts 1 and 2 of the FBA tests from WMU qualify for use of the How2Recycle logo.

Paper Packaging: A Durable Packaging Choice

In addition to caring for the environment, a sustainable paper package can protect the goods it carries throughout the supply chain. Creating a paper package that is sturdy enough to withstand the rigors of the shipping process includes both tests and coatings to protect it from its environment.

Paper is Strong

Do you ever wonder how your mail or packages stay intact during transit? The secret lies in the paper’s composition. Tests like ISTA 6 Flexible SIOC and TAPPI 403 Burst strength can determine just how strong a package’s paper really is. To increase its strength, some packages feature heavier paper basis weights, or even a 2-ply layer composition.

Want to protect your package from moisture or weather during delivery? Consider a water-based coating that’s both recyclable and durable. With these techniques, you can rest assured your paper packaging is up to the challenges (and weather) posed by the supply chain.

In October 2018, the Ellen MacArthur Foundation, a global nonprofit committed to creating a circular economy, set out clear, urgent actions for businesses and governments to take to eliminate plastic and outlined ambitious targets for reducing virgin plastic use by 2025. By November 2022, a New Plastics Economy Global Commitment progress report indicated this commitment to use only reusable, recyclable or compostable plastic packaging would not likely be met by 2025, resulting in the Ellen MacArthur Foundation’s placing a fresh-acceleration spotlight on businesses urging them to create credible, ambitious plans to scale reuse, deal with the issue of flexible packaging and reduce the need for single-use packaging

The heat is on for Consumer Packaged Goods (CPG) companies to source sustainable packaging solutions. A recent report by the Packaging Machinery Manufacturers Institute (PMMI), Packaging Sustainability: A Changing Landscape, details how CPG’s sustainable packaging strategies include: 

  • Reducing – Minimizing packaging to reduce waste. 
  • Reusing – Implementing reusable packaging. 
  • Recycling – Designing recyclable packaging. 
  • Reformatting – Redesigning packaging using more sustainable materials. 
  • Renewing – Choosing renewable-sourced materials. 

Plastic Packaging: A Sustainable Option 

Polyethylene is one of the most widely used plastics in the world. A bag made with polyethylene, or a polybag, is widely used in the packaging industry due to its durable, pliable and protective qualities. Despite being a plastic product, a polybag can still be considered as a sustainable packaging alternative – especially when the following CPG sustainable packaging strategies are considered: 

Reducing: Minimizing Packaging to Reduce Waste

Options to reduce the amount of poly used in a package includes right-sizing bags or using thinner or “downgauged” packaging such as Linear-Low Density Polyethylene (L-LDPE). 

L-LDPE refers to the type of resin that makes up the plastic in the polybag. L-LDPE is popular for its strength, impact resistance and puncture resistance. L-LDPE is tough, boasting a higher tensile strength than regular low-density polyethylene (LDPE), and this allows L-LDPE to consist of thinner films without compromising the strength of the material, making it an ideal substrate for packaging applications.  

Reusing: Implementing Reusable Packaging

Two-way packages are popular in the apparel segment where returns and exchanges are highly-likely. Shippers who provide a perforation and double-adhesive strip on the initial package enabling it to double as a return vessel if needed — creates an opportunity for that package to extend beyond single use.  

Recycling: Designing Recyclable Packaging

Did you know polybags can be recycled as a low-density polyethylene or number 4 plastic? Nearly 10,000 retailers and grocers nationwide accept number 4 plastics (e.g., polybags) for recycling. For more information, or to find a number 4 plastic recycling facility in your area, consult the resources at How2Recycle.    

Reformatting: Redesigning Packaging Using More Sustainable Materials 

Polybags made with post-consumer resin (PCR) and/or post-industrial content (PIC) can protect your both products and the environment. The amount of PCR and/or PIC contained in a polybag is expressed in percentages, yet the percentage of PCR and/or PIC included in a package can vary greatly, depending on the specific intended application and end use for the bag. There is a limit to how much PCR and/or PIC a polybag can contain and still maintaining the desired strength, sealability and integrity. Testing is critical to determine the appropriate amount of PCR and/or PIC to be included in a polybag.    

Renewing: Choosing Renewable-sourced Materials 

Packages marked as “compostable” are biodegradable, meaning the packaging materials can break down into tiny pieces that can be safely digested by microorganisms. Biodegradable packaging can be made from bio-based and fossil-based polymers, and there are some petroleum-based plastics composed of weaker carbon chains that degrade efficiently and completely (e.g., polybutylene adipate terephthalate or PBAT, a fully biodegradable polymer) while maintaining the strength and flexibility that makes plastic packaging so attractive for packaging manufacturers.
